Sexual selection and the evolution of evolvability.
Heredity - 1 Apr 2007
Petrie M, Roberts G
Abstract excerpt
Here we show that sexual selection can have an effect on the rate of mutation. We simulated the fate of a genetic modifier of the mutation rate in a sexual population with and without sexual selection (modelled using a female choice mechanism). Female choice for 'good genes' should reduce variability among male subjects, leaving insufficient differences to maintain female preferences. However, female choice can...
